The risk reduction action among IDU’s is needed to reduce the emerging of new case of HIV transmission through their risk behavior either in drug using practices and sexual practices. This study was aimed to analyze determinant factors to risk reduction action of HIV transmission among IDU’s in Makassar City. It was an explanatory study, employs a cross sectional research design and combining between Health Belief Model and Social Learning Theory. Target population in this research was all IDU’s in Makassar City that have been reached by three NGOs and involving in individual risk assessment. There were 97 respondents involved in this research, selected by applying systematic random sampling technique. Questionnaire was used for collect data and analyze with chi square to measure bivariate correlation. Logistic regression was employed for multivariate analysis. Out of the 97 IDU’s, 60,8% IDU’s experienced consistency in risk reduction action adherence. Logistic regression analysis showed that risk reduction action dominantly influence by knowledge of HIV/AIDS.
